FCT Minister Nyesom Wike has vowed to make things difficult for African Democratic Congress (ADC) presidential candidate Atiku Abubakar and other opposition candidates ahead of the 2027 general elections.

Wike made the remark on Friday, August 21, in Abuja while speaking to journalists during an inspection of infrastructure projects in the Federal Capital Territory.

The minister dismissed claims that the opposition currently has a strong political force, arguing that the crisis within the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) has weakened its position as the leading opposition party.

He said his priority was not to help opposition politicians succeed, adding that he intended to keep them under pressure ahead of the election.

“I don’t want them to feel well. My job is to make them feel unwell all day because they will have high blood pressure. I think that’s my job,” Wike said.

He added that he was not concerned about the opposition’s performance and would continue making things difficult for them.

“I’m not here to make them perform well. And that is what we are doing to them. So, we have to be patient,” he said.
